Transaction 7590ae22e7acc38c387d08802cd1deedf9e2f71194949d2f646782e7b1dfac6c

1 Input
2 Outputs
  • 7590ae22e7acc38c387d08802cd1deedf9e2f71194949d2f646782e7b1dfac6c:0
  • value  469377
    address  3KxmE7EnJXXoPmvWTAGPc1JuuPTd43gHEa
  • 7590ae22e7acc38c387d08802cd1deedf9e2f71194949d2f646782e7b1dfac6c:1
  • value  4483418
    address  14iWqbbQjopMuek8hxXdehsiMuxd9iH2JF